Unsure how the UK pensions industry actually works? Not to worry, we have it covered in today’s AIM High episode: The legacy and leadership of the UK pensions industry. Accompanying Twink to discuss this subject is Charlotte Moore, a freelance Communications Consultant and Jo Sharples, Partner at Aon. 

Themes covered in this podcast: 

  • The UK pensions industry landscape and how defined benefit (DB) pensions schemes have evolved 
  • The challenges pension schemes face in relation to the UK government’s ‘investments big bang’ push 
  • Are the UK government and the UK regulator at odds with each other over risk? 
  • The knock on effect of Osborne’s pensions reforms and freedom of choice 
  • Challenges for DB and defined contribution (DC) pension schemes in the next 5 – 10 years and how pension schemes will evolve 
  • How marketers of institutional houses can do a better job in communicating with gatekeepers of big pension schemes
